zoukankan      html  css  js  c++  java
  • CentOS7离线安装Mysql(详细安装过程)

    Mysql安装

    下载mysql离线安装包

    https://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.27-1.el7.x86_64.rpm-bundle.tar

    解压后执行安装:

    cd /root/mysql-5.7.27-1.el7.x86_64.rpm-bundle

    rpm -Uvh *.rpm --nodeps --force

    Mysql配置

    1.首先关闭mysql服务:

    service mysqld stop

    2.然后修改配置文件:

    vi /etc/my.cnf

    3.接下来加入一句代码即可空密码登录mysql:

    # Disabling symbolic-links is recommended to prevent assorted security risks
    skip-grant-tables     #添加这句话,这时候登入mysql就不需要密码
    symbolic-links=0

    4.开启mysql服务:

    service mysqld start

    5.空密码登录mysql:

    mysql -u root -p    #输入命令回车进入,出现输入密码提示直接回车

    6.设置mysql密码:

    mysql> set password for root@localhost = password('123456');
    ERROR 1290 (HY000): The MySQL server is running with the --skip-grant-tables option so it cannot execute this statement
    mysql> flush privileges;  #更新权限
    Query OK, 0 rows affected (0.00 sec)
    mysql> set password for root@localhost = password('123456'); 
    Query OK, 0 rows affected, 1 warning (0.00 sec)
    mysql>flush privileges; #更新权限
    mysql>quit; #退出
    service mysqld stop # 停止mysql服务, 恢复mysql配置
    vim /etc/my.cnf     #修改配置文件
    # Disabling symbolic-links is recommended to prevent assorted security risks
    # skip-grant-tables # 注释掉这句话
    symbolic-links=0
    service mysqld start # 启动mysql服务
    mysql -uroot -p # 输入新密码登录

    7.设置mysql开机自启:

    systemctl enable mysqld
  • 相关阅读:
    1.2顺序表
    1.1数据结构
    Java 造假数据
    Python造假数据,用这个库
    真香 用这七大Python效率工具
    mybatis 详情
    MySQL 的 INSERT ··· ON DUPLICATE KEY UPDATE
    mysql之case when then 经典用法
    SELECT NOW(),CURDATE(),CURTIME()
    MySQL CONCAT_WS 函数
  • 原文地址:https://www.cnblogs.com/JustinLau/p/11345089.html
Copyright © 2011-2022 走看看